Dog Henry, from Fremantle, Australia, made a miracle recovery after being stabbed twice in the chest by a car thief. His owner’s van was stolen with him still inside in May 2019.Owners Steve and Kim Reid raised £7,000 in a single day to cover the cost of his life-staving surgery.But he was diagnosed with blood cancer just two months after the operation.A Facebook page for the dog said: “Steve and I are so sad to let all Henry’s friends know, that our boy passed away today.“Nearly 17-years-old.

He lasted one year and a week after he was kidnapped and stabbed.“Our hearts will always miss our Henry."Thank you to everyone who were so kind when Henry was hurt.
